How much does a Health Educator make in the United States? The average Health Educator salary in the United States is $60,536 as of November 27, 2023, but the range typically falls between $53,688 and $67,888.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on many important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ession. Percentile | Salary | Location | Last Updated |
10th Percentile Health Educator Salary | $47,454 | US | November 27, 2023 |
25th Percentile Health Educator Salary | $53,688 | US | November 27, 2023 |
50th Percentile Health Educator Salary | $60,536 | US | November 27, 2023 |
75th Percentile Health Educator Salary | $67,888 | US | November 27, 2023 |
90th Percentile Health Educator Salary | $74,581 | US | November 27, 2023 |

Health Educator assists with developing and designing health education programs meant to increase community awareness and knowledge. Conducts needs assessments and keeps up-to-date on changes in health care technology to keep program material current. Being a Health Educator presents, coordinates, and disseminates educational resources and materials. Assists with health education outreach and consultation. Additionally, Health Educator may require a bachelor's degree in a related area. Typically reports to a manager or head of a unit/department. The Health Educator occasionally directed in several aspects of the work. Gaining exposure to some of the complex tasks within the job function. To be a Health Educator typically requires 2-4 years of related experience. (Copyright 2023 Salary.com)... View full job description
